A native of Rocky River, Ohio, she was born the daughter of the late Walter H. and Martha Reiser Manns. She had previously resided in Oregon, Indiana, Ohio, Wilmette, Ill., and had retired to Grantham, N.H. for 12 years prior to moving to Tryon, where she has lived for the past ten years.

Mrs. May was devoted to her husband and a wonderful mother to her four sons. She was a talented painter and enjoyed interior decorating, home design, golf and her church. She was a member of Grace Lutheran Church and Tryon Painters and Sculptors.
